Pei-Lun He is a scholar working on Atomic and Molecular Physics, and Optics, Spectroscopy and Nuclear and High Energy Physics. According to data from OpenAlex, Pei-Lun He has authored 27 papers receiving a total of 476 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Atomic and Molecular Physics, and Optics, 9 papers in Spectroscopy and 6 papers in Nuclear and High Energy Physics. Recurrent topics in Pei-Lun He's work include Laser-Matter Interactions and Applications (23 papers), Advanced Fiber Laser Technologies (12 papers) and Mass Spectrometry Techniques and Applications (9 papers). Pei-Lun He is often cited by papers focused on Laser-Matter Interactions and Applications (23 papers), Advanced Fiber Laser Technologies (12 papers) and Mass Spectrometry Techniques and Applications (9 papers). Pei-Lun He collaborates with scholars based in China, Germany and Japan. Pei-Lun He's co-authors include Feng He, Karen Z. Hatsagortsyan, Christoph H. Keitel, Jian Wu, Yue-Yue Chen, Rashid Shaisultanov, Xiaochun Gong, Qinying Ji, Qiying Song and Haifeng Pan and has published in prestigious journals such as Physical Review Letters, Nature Communications and Physical Review A.
